Our dedicated plans are not artificially limited in any way and therefore highly recommended for your production environment. The maximum performance is determined by the underlaying instance type and the number of nodes you chose.
Little Lemur and Tough Tiger instances are virtual hosts (vhosts) located on a shared server where other users actions might affect the performance of the whole server. All shared plans has a channel limit set to 200.
Each plan is benchmark tested, the speed given is the burst speed; Maximum number of messages you can send per second for your instance during a certain amount of time. Number of messages per second depends a lot on type of routing, size of messages, how many conumers/publishers you have, datacenter, auto ack/persistence flags etc.

All servers are continuously monitored for availability and performance. Most often we detect and address issues before they become a problem. If there is a problem with an instance it's automatically removed from the DNS load-balancer.
RabbitMQ is a polyglot broker and all our plans has protocol support for AMQP, AMQPS, HTTPS, STOMP and MQTT.
All instances have access to RabbitMQ's management interface which is great for monitoring and inspection.
In a cluster (two nodes or more) all queues and messages are replicated between the nodes so if one node fails the other can immediately take over without message loss. Fail-over and load-balancing is performed over DNS, with a very low TTL.
All plans are billed by the second, so you can try out even the largest instance types for mere pennies. Billing occurs at the end of each month, and you're only charged for the time an instance has been available to you.
